Lesotho
Lesotho is a landlocked country and enclave, completely surrounded by South Africa. It is just over 30,000 square kilometres in size and has a population slightly over two million. The name Lesotho translates roughly into the land of the people who speak Sesotho. About 40% of the population live below the international poverty line of $1.25 a day.
